[jboss-cvs] jboss-seam/src/main/org/jboss/seam/core ...
Gavin King
gavin at belmont.prod.atl2.jboss.com
Wed Aug 30 21:38:29 EDT 2006
User: gavin
Date: 06/08/30 21:38:29
Modified: src/main/org/jboss/seam/core Manager.java
Log:
fixed breakage
Revision Changes Path
1.83 +7 -3 jboss-seam/src/main/org/jboss/seam/core/Manager.java
(In the diff below, changes in quantity of whitespace are not shown.)
Index: Manager.java
===================================================================
RCS file: /cvsroot/jboss/jboss-seam/src/main/org/jboss/seam/core/Manager.java,v
retrieving revision 1.82
retrieving revision 1.83
diff -u -b -r1.82 -r1.83
--- Manager.java 29 Aug 2006 23:15:23 -0000 1.82
+++ Manager.java 31 Aug 2006 01:38:29 -0000 1.83
@@ -44,7 +44,7 @@
*
* @author Gavin King
* @author <a href="mailto:theute at jboss.org">Thomas Heute</a>
- * @version $Revision: 1.82 $
+ * @version $Revision: 1.83 $
*/
@Scope(ScopeType.EVENT)
@Name("org.jboss.seam.core.manager")
@@ -898,7 +898,7 @@
* into the request URL.
*
* @param viewId the JSF view id
- * @param parameters request parameters to be encoded
+ * @param parameters request parameters to be encoded (possibly null)
* @param includeConversationId determines if the conversation id is to be encoded
*/
public void redirect(String viewId, Map<String, Object> parameters, boolean includeConversationId)
@@ -909,7 +909,11 @@
{
url = encodeParameters(url, parameters);
}
- url = encodeParameters( url, RenderParameters.instance() );
+ Map<String, Object> renderParameters = RenderParameters.instance();
+ if (renderParameters!=null)
+ {
+ url = encodeParameters(url, renderParameters);
+ }
if (includeConversationId)
{
url = encodeConversationId(url);
More information about the jboss-cvs-commits
mailing list